Course Content

• **Fundamentals of Machine Learning for Healthcare:** This unit covers core ML concepts, algorithms (supervised, unsupervised, reinforcement learning), and their applications in healthcare.
• **Data Preprocessing and Feature Engineering for Health Data:** Focuses on handling missing values, outliers, and transforming raw health data into suitable formats for ML models. Keywords: Data Cleaning, Feature Selection
• **Natural Language Processing (NLP) for Health Communication:** Explores techniques for analyzing and understanding unstructured health data like medical records and social media posts. Keywords: Sentiment Analysis, Text Mining, Healthcare NLP
• **Machine Learning Model Development and Evaluation:** Covers model selection, training, validation, and performance evaluation metrics specifically tailored for healthcare applications. Keywords: Model Tuning, Bias Mitigation
• **Ethical Considerations in Machine Learning for Health:** Addresses ethical implications, bias detection, fairness, privacy, and responsible AI development in healthcare. Keywords: AI Ethics, Data Privacy, Explainable AI
• **Deployment and Monitoring of Machine Learning Models:** Covers strategies for deploying models in real-world healthcare settings and monitoring their performance over time.
• **Advanced Deep Learning Techniques for Health Imaging:** Explores convolutional neural networks (CNNs) and other deep learning methods for analyzing medical images (e.g., X-rays, MRI scans). Keywords: Image Recognition, Computer Vision
• **Health Communication Strategies and ML Integration:** This unit bridges the gap between ML outputs and effective communication strategies for patients and healthcare providers. Keywords: Health Literacy, Patient Engagement
